9487.2 Inspectors and Testers, Electrical Apparatus Manufacturing
Inspectors and testers, electrical apparatus manufacturing, inspect and test completed parts and production items.

Main Characteristics
Occupations in this group are characterized by the following aptitudes, interests and worker functions as they relate to main duties:
- General learning ability to inspect and test completed electrical parts and production items
- Motor co-ordination and manual dexterity to check in-process and completed production items for mechanical defects
- Methodical interest in copying information to collect, record and summarize inspection results; and in marking acceptable and defective assemblies
- Objective interest in operating testing equipment to maintain quality of products
- Directive interest in handling products during inspections to identify and return faulty assemblies to production for repairs

Education/Training
2
- Some secondary school education is usually required.
- On-the-job training is provided.
- Inspectors may require experience as an assembler in the same company.
Electric appliance manufacturing companies
Electrical equipment manufacturing companies
Progression to supervisory positions is possible with experience.
